Pope: Celebrations, including Mass, are essential for family life. Pope Francis holds a cake he received from a newly married couple during his weekly audience in Paul VI hall at the Vatican Aug. 12. (CNS photo/Remo Casilli, Reuters). By Cindy Wooden, Catholic News Service. VATICAN CITY (CNS) Families need moments of rest and celebration, time for standing back and recognizing the gifts of God and how well they have developed, Pope Francis said.
